BEIJING, July 27 -- The Chinese PLA Navy's 83rd task force, comprising the training ship Qijiguang (Hull 83) and amphibious dock landing ship Kunlunshan (Hull 998), arrived at Muara Port in Brunei on July 24, 2026, to begin a four-day goodwill visit as part of its far-seas internship training and visit mission.

During the visit, the task force organized a series of exchange activities to commemorate the 35th anniversary of the establishment of diplomatic relations between China and Brunei. Some members of the task force went to Brunei's military facilities, defense academy and universities for exchanges. The two sides conducted mutual ship visits and friendly sports matches. On the evening of July 26, the task force hosted the on-deck reception to celebrate the 99th anniversary of the founding of the Chinese People's Liberation Army. Meanwhile, the task force dispatched some members to stage performances and conduct community outreach for local people. These activities have further strengthened friendship between the two militaries and the two peoples of China and Brunei.
